European Dream Carnival to be held in Latvia for the first time

BC, Riga, 02.05.2016.Print version

Marking the European Day, the European Dream Carnival will be organized in Latvia for the first time by the European Parliament Information Bureau (EPIB) in Latvia, informs LETA.

 

The event will be held in Latvia's southwestern Liepaja city on May 5 and eastwestern Daugavpils city on May 16.

 

Presenting the idea of the European Carnival, EPIB Latvia head Marta Ribele said that more than 60 years ago people dared to dream and had a future vision of a united Europe that later turned into the European Union.

 

"Those were brave people with brave ideas," said Ribele, adding that the idea of the European Carnival is to demonstrate Europe's common values to the young people in an attractive and inspiring way.

 

Schools competed for the opportunity to host the European Dream Carnival and two schools from Liepaja and Daugavpils won in the competition.

 

The events will be attended by Latvian MEPs Artis Pabriks (Unity) and Andrejs Mamikins (Harmony), representatives of local governments, and musician Joran Steinhauer, who represented Latvia in the Eurovision Song Contest 2014 with his Aarzemnieki band.

 

During the carnival, teams of pupils will compete for the main prize – the Euroscola event at the European Parliament in Strasbourg.
